在AWS的API网关的单个资源中可以有多个http方法吗?

时间:2020-07-13 08:24:55

标签: amazon-web-services aws-api-gateway devops

我正在尝试使用AWS中的API网关。

enter image description here

这两种方法具有相同的API端点。默认情况下,它正在调用为GET方法设置的lambda函数。

我觉得我在这里某个地方错过了一个把戏。

我应该为PUT方法创建其他资源还是在具有不同api端点的相同资源中使用它?

1 个答案:

答案 0 :(得分:1)

或者,您可以使用ANY方法,但是您将在Lambda中负责解释您如何处理不想支持的任何方法。

您也可以在非代理资源上设置ANY方法。将ANY方法与代理资源相结合,您将针对API的任何资源为所有受支持的HTTP方法设置一个API方法。此外,后端可以发展而不会破坏现有的API设置。

更多信息here